Output e3ce607f923ad0df4965543658ad0ec369e6e464e041a4973791d49631f60919:5

value
116713084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3e39f8ddcfca6994132b2bd16c35c8482039e2 OP_EQUAL
address
3BNn6SutxBQye1FfBTGW15SnUaHtKJ9Xrx
transaction
e3ce607f923ad0df4965543658ad0ec369e6e464e041a4973791d49631f60919
confirmations
246542
spent
true